Factors Affecting the Accuracy of Linear Motion with Rolling Linear Guideways
High-precision linear motion mechanisms are widely used in machine tools, industrial robots, measuring instruments, and other applications. With the increasing prevalence of their use, the demands for the motion accuracy of rolling linear guideways are also becoming increasingly stringent. Motion accuracy refers to the degree of proximity between the actual and theoretical positions of a point in space during motion. The motion accuracy of a rolling linear guideway is a key performance indicator, directly affecting its lifespan. Currently, the primary method for detecting the motion accuracy of rolling linear guideways involves measurement using dial indicators. As a linear motion mechanism, the theoretical motion trajectory of any point on the slider should be a straight line. However, in reality, the rolling linear guideway is subject to factors such as manufacturing precision, friction, and installation accuracy, causing three-directional variations in the slider's movement during operation. This means that the slider of a rolling linear guideway exhibits linear motion errors during operation. Linear motion error is based on linearity. Linear motion error can be defined as the linearity error along the direction of motion; linearity error is the variation of the measured actual profile line relative to the ideal straight line.
